Output 3c80ca2937273700819ccd738cefe94f07f4565c0adf854d85d6d463e2096779:1

value
69466
script pubkey
OP_0 OP_PUSHBYTES_20 8880ba2654b476948b07516cb9ac53a5614ddde2
address
ltc1q3zqt5fj5k3mffzc829ktntzn54s5mh0z3kyxyh
transaction
3c80ca2937273700819ccd738cefe94f07f4565c0adf854d85d6d463e2096779
spent
true